






The BY81 series intelligent capacitors combine measurement and control technologies, employing synchronous switching for precise control, eliminating jitter, and extending service life to one million cycles. They offer high reliability, low failure rate, and low power consumption. Their rational compensation methods and full-featured design provide superior performance, including advanced power analysis capabilities, and can be equipped with various peripherals. Multiple units can be modularly combined, automatically generating a master unit and switching automatically in case of faults, featuring highly intelligent and intuitive operating status displays. There is no inrush current during shutdown, zero-crossing switching avoids over voltage, breakdown, arcing, and impact. Their comprehensive measurement and protection functions cover temperature, harmonics, phase loss, and three-phase imbalance protection.
The BY81 series intelligent capacitors, with△-type (2 units) or Y-type (1 unit) low-voltage power capacitors as the core, integrate microelectronics, sensing, network and advanced manufacturing technologies to achieve intelligence, miniaturization and modularization, representing a major breakthrough in low-voltage reactive power compensation technology. Featuring a simple structure, easy production and lower cost, they can improve performance and simplify maintenance. They can be flexibly adapted to various low-voltage reactive power compensation scenarios, completely innovating the traditional equipment mode.

The product consists of intelligent components, synchronous switching switch electrical components, current sampling components, and low-voltage power capacitors.

MCU Intelligent Measurement & Control
Industrial-grade wide-temperature components, resistant to harsh environments, long-term stable operation,excellent intelligent control.
MCU Intelligent Measurement & Control
Independently developed, microelectronics controls mechanical contacts, zero-crossing switching, avoids inrush current, reduces loss,extends life.
Low-Voltage Power Capacitor
Self-healing, zinc-aluminum metallized film dielectric,high stability. Small-capacity parallel connection reduces loss and fault,built-in temperature control,over-temperature protection.
